Tenet Healthcare's Q2 2021 results reflected long-term strategy and transformation progress.
Tenet Healthcare reported a strong second quarter in 2021, with net income from continuing operations available to common shareholders of $120 million, or $1.11 per diluted share, compared to $88 million, or $0.83 per diluted share, in Q2 2020. Adjusted EBITDA was $834 million, and adjusted diluted earnings per share from continuing operations were $1.59. The company raised its full-year 2021 financial guidance, citing continued growth, operational improvements, and grant income.
- Net income from continuing operations available to common shareholders in Q2 2021 was $120 million, compared to $88 million in Q2 2020.
- Consolidated Adjusted EBITDA in Q2 2021 was $834 million versus $732 million in Q2 2020.
- Diluted earnings per share from continuing operations available to common shareholders in Q2 2021 was $1.11 compared to $0.83 in Q2 2020; Adjusted diluted earnings per share from continuing operations of $1.59 in Q2 2021 compared to $1.26 in Q2 2020.
- The FY 2021 Outlook was increased due to continued growth and operational improvements as well as grant income.

Forward guidance
Tenet Healthcare raised its full-year 2021 outlook, expecting net operating revenues between $19.250 billion and $19.650 billion, Adjusted EBITDA between $3.150 billion and $3.250 billion, and Adjusted diluted earnings per share between $5.23 and $5.73.
Tailwinds
- Net operating revenues are expected to be between $19,250 million and $19,650 million.
- Adjusted EBITDA is projected to be between $3,150 million and $3,250 million.
- Diluted income per common share from continuing operations is anticipated to be between $6.25 and $7.17.
- Adjusted net income from continuing operations is expected to be between $570 million and $625 million.
- Adjusted diluted earnings per share from continuing operations are projected to be between $5.23 and $5.73.
Headwinds
- Interest expense is expected to be between $935 million and $945 million.
- Depreciation and amortization are projected to be between $850 million and $870 million.
- Capital expenditures are estimated to be between $700 million and $750 million.
- NCI cash distributions are expected to be between $460 million and $480 million.
- Effective tax rate is projected to be ~17%.
